x/crypto/bcrypt: add cooperative scheduling and cancellation to bcrypt
Password hashing functions like bcrypt are very CPU intensive and long running. On my Apple m1 chip, it takes about 75,455 microseconds for one password hash to be generated with the current DefaultCost of 10. Furthermore, the current algorithm is not cooperative with the rest of the Goroutines in the system, which can relatively easily create latency issues on other less CPU intensive Goroutines. This is in-particular a major issue in web servers implementing sign-in / sign-up with password.
This PR adds CompareHashAndPasswordWithContext and GenerateHashWithContext functions that call into runtime.Gosched() every 64 bcrypt rounds (i.e. about every 4.7 ms on m1). These also allow obeying a cancellation signal from the context. The existing functions are intentionally not cooperative.
(I'm open to tweaking the number of rounds.)
